- What is Werner Enterprises's increase (decrease) in fair value of interest rate fair value hedging instruments?
- Werner Enterprises (WERN) reported increase (decrease) in fair value of interest rate fair value hedging instruments of $1.69M in Q1 2026.
- How has Werner Enterprises's increase (decrease) in fair value of interest rate fair value hedging instruments changed year-over-year?
- Werner Enterprises's increase (decrease) in fair value of interest rate fair value hedging instruments increased by 218.0% year-over-year, from -$1.43M to $1.69M.
- What is the long-term trend for Werner Enterprises's increase (decrease) in fair value of interest rate fair value hedging instruments?
- Over 4 years (2021 to 2025), Werner Enterprises's increase (decrease) in fair value of interest rate fair value hedging instruments has grown at a -15.6%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$3.61M to $1.83M.
- What does increase (decrease) in fair value of interest rate fair value hedging instruments mean?
- This represents the non-cash change in the fair value of financial instruments used to hedge against interest rate volatility. It reflects the effectiveness and market-driven valuation of the company's interest rate risk management strategy. Investors use this to understand how market interest rate shifts impact the company's derivative portfolio.
